8 Reed Mace Drive is a freehold detached house on Reed Mace Drive in B61. It last sold for £475,000 in 2016 — its 2nd recorded sale, up 49% on its first recorded sale of £318,500 in 2002.

What a home of this era typically means
  • Insulated cavity walls and double glazing become the norm, so thermal performance is markedly better than pre-war stock.

When did 8 Reed Mace Drive last sell, and for how much?

8 Reed Mace Drive last sold for £475,000 on 3 Oct 2016, according to HM Land Registry.

How many times has 8 Reed Mace Drive been sold?

HM Land Registry records 2 sales for 8 Reed Mace Drive between 2002 and 2016. Sales before 1995 are not in the public dataset.

How big is 8 Reed Mace Drive?

Its most recent Energy Performance Certificate records 245 m² of floor area.

What council tax band is 8 Reed Mace Drive?

8 Reed Mace Drive is in council tax band G, costing about £4,132 a year (Bromsgrove).

How energy efficient is 8 Reed Mace Drive?

Its most recent EPC rates it D (score 59). Its recommended improvements would take it to C.
